A MAN has been charged in connection with an incident at a Bromsgrove nightclub which saw three people sprayed with CS gas.
Two women and a man, all in their 20s suffered sore eyes and reddening to their faces at Love2Love, Worcester Road, in the town centre at around 2am Saturday night (November 24).
The man did not require medical attention, but the women was taken to Redditch's Alexandra Hospital for treatment.
Ryan Prescott, 20, of Brentford Close, Kings Heath, Birmingham appeared at Redditch Magistrates court today (Monday) facing three charges of assault, and two charges of possessing a weapon for the discharge of noxious liquid or gas, and administering poison.
He was granted conditional bail and will appear at Worcester crown court on Thursday December 6.
